With Lifetime movie debut, abuse survivor pushes for awareness in Mennonite, Amish communities

Summary by Ground News
Joanna Yoder started advocating for sexual abuse survivors in small ways. She took the next step by speaking with the Pittsburgh Post-Gazette for a Pulitzer Prize-finalist series. Now, Yoder, an abuse survivor who grew up conservative Mennonite, is the consultant on a new Lifetime film.
